Exceptional People Exceptional Care: Radius Care is a New Zealand owned and operated company; we specialise in health and aged care for the elderly and disabled. Currently we have 24 locations nationwide, employing over 1800 staff and providing professional aged care for more than 1700 residents. We are one of the leading health care providers in New Zealand.
This role sits within Radius Care’s Homecare services, supporting clients to live safely and independently in their own homes.

About the role:
As our Clinical Coordinator, you’ll oversee the delivery of safe, responsive care for clients in their homes. You’ll coordinate services, support and develop Support Workers, and work closely with clients, whanau, and external health professionals to ensure excellent outcomes.
This role combines clinical oversight, service coordination, leadership, and customer experience, with the opportunity to help grow a greenfield service.
What you’ll be doing:
Assess clients’ needs and develop personalized care plans
Provide clinical oversight and monitor client outcomes
Coordinate care delivered by Support Workers and clinical staff
Act as a key point of contact for clients, whanau, and referrers
Support recruitment, onboarding, induction and development of staff
Work with training and people teams to ensure capability and compliance
Ensure documentation, audits, and incident management are completed to a high standard
Build strong relationships with GPs, community teams, ACC and other providers
Contribute to service growth, quality improvement, and workforce planning
